UEFA Women's EURO moved to 2022

MINSK, 24 April (BelTA) – The 2021 UEFA Women's European Championship has been postponed to 2022. The UEFA Executive Committee took the corresponding decision during a video conference on 23 April, BelTA has learned.

The postponed UEFA Women's EURO 2021 will be played in England from 6 to 31 July 2022. The tournament was initially due to take place in summer 2021, but the decision was taken to move it in the light of the COVID-19 pandemic.

The Belarusian women's national team coached by Yuri Maleyev had to play the Women's EURO 2021 qualifier against Northern Ireland in Minsk on 14 April. In Group C Belarus secured a 6-0 win against Faroe Islands in Borisov and lost 1-7 to Norway and 0-1 to Wales. The Group C standings are as follows: Norway – 12 points (four matches), Wales – 8 (4), Belarus – 3 (3), Northern Ireland – 2 (4), Faroe Islands – 0 (3).

The UEFA Executive Committee also recommended the national associations to complete top domestic competitions so that EURO berths were distributed on sporting merit.
